this week the leader of the Republican Party--their candidate for President--was seen in a video speaking at a fundraising meeting with wealthy campaign donors in Florida. In the privacy of the event, Mitt Romney spilled to the donors there what he really thinks about nearly half of the American people. That is almost 150 million people. He disparagingly said 47 percent of Americans support President Obama simply because they do not owe Federal income taxes or they are getting benefits from a government program. Just to make sure there is no misquote here, this is Mitt Romney's statement. He said: There are 47 percent who are with him-- ``Him'' being President Obama who are dependent on government, who believe that they are victims. . . . my job-- Mitt Romney says-- is not to worry about those people. I'll never convince them that they should take personal responsibility and care for their lives. This is coming from the leader of the Republican Party, a man who is running to represent every American--all 310 million--from the Nation's highest office. These comments are disturbing coming from anybody, but coming from him they are a disgrace. In plain English, he says that if you do not pay Federal income tax or you receive a government benefit, then you do not take responsibility personally for your life. So who are these 47 percent for whom Mitt Romney and his Republican friends feel such contempt?…
